Finalists for the Restaurant Association Metropolitan Washington’s  2019 awards, known as the Rammys, were announced Monday and there are five from Montgomery County establishments. Silver Spring’s Quarry House Tavern has nominees in two categories.

The nominees from Montgomery County and the categories:

• Republic in Takoma Park – Beer Program of the Year
• Chef Javier Fernandez of Kuya Ja’s Lechon Belly in Rockville – Rising Culinary Star of the Year
• Quarry House Tavern in Silver Spring – Favorite Gathering Place of the Year
• Quarry House Tavern owners Jackie Greenbaum and Gordon Banks – Restaurateur of the Year
• Sabrine Marques of PassionFish Bethesda – Manager of the Year

There are five finalists selected in each category.

- Advertisement -

Any RAMW member meeting the category requirements is eligible to receive the regional honors, selected by the public and an anonymous panel of judges.

Winners will be announced at a June 30 gala.

Urban Plates opens in Westfield Montgomery mall

The fast-casual restaurant debuted its third East Coast location with a ribbon-cutting and is now open for business.

Urban Plates is expected to open restaurants in Chevy Chase and Gaithersburg later this year.

St. Patrick’s Day specials at Caddies

The Bethesda bar and grill will have food and drink deals all weekend long. Customers can enjoy green bar, Jameson whiskey and Reuben sandwiches to celebrate the shamrock season.

Caddies will also have a green eggs and ham brunch from 11 a.m. to 3:30 p.m. Saturday and Sunday, with bottomless Irish coffee and mimosas.

The restaurant will be giving away samples of Jameson, Guinness and Bud Light for patrons wearing the most festive outfits.

All-day breakfast, new items at Modern Market Eatery

The restaurant has added a Mediterranean Bowl, seasonal vegetables and breakfast options including avocado toast and dessert waffles, available anytime.

The menu will be updated March 27.

The new bowl uses 100 percent grass-fed beef, which is not only delicious but better for the environment, Chef Nate Weir said in a statement.

There are Modern Market restaurants in Bethesda and Rockville.

Matchbox celebrates Pi Day

The pizza bistro will have its Marchbox IPA for $3.14 all day at every location in honor of March 14.

The restaurant has a Rockville location and one coming to Bethesda this summer.
